What Is Masonry Concrete. Masonry involves laying down single pieces of building material at a time. The masonry units are bound together. Masonry, the art and craft of building and fabricating in stone, clay, brick, or concrete block. It involves stacking materials and using mortar to. Construction of poured concrete, reinforced or unreinforced, is often also considered masonry. The art of masonry originated when early man sought to supplement his valuable but rare natural caves with artificial caves made from piles of stone. Masonry refers to the construction of structures using individual units, typically made of natural materials like brick, concrete blocks, or stone. The main difference is that masonry is the name of a building practice using other materials, while concrete is a type of building material. Concrete masonry construction (or as it is more commonly called, concrete blockwork) is based on thousands of years experience in building structures of stone, mud and clay bricks. But while the two are very different, they often go hand in hand. Masonry is the craft of building structures from stone, brick, concrete, and other similar materials. Masonry and concrete vary widely in the construction process.
